The Effectiveness of Outdoor Learning to Improve English Skills at Aceh Islamic Nature School (AINS) Rahmad Syah Putra; M Khatami; Rahmat Kurniawan

Abstract

The existence of outdoor learning that began to be carried out by nature schools became an exciting learning method. This outdoor learning activity raises interest in students' enthusiasm for learning because students get new experiences and discover new things. This study used a qualitative method and was conducted at the Aceh Islamic Nature School (AINS) by examining students' understanding of English using outdoor learning. Data collection techniques were carried out by observing and interviewing English teachers at the school. As a finding, learning English with outdoor learning methods has various ways, such as inviting students to know directly in English. For each material, a song is sung together so they can remember the lesson and the material studied. Outdoor learning at AINS also has adequate supporting factors, such as the provision of vocabulary stickers on the walls of spaces/objects. The teacher gets used to speaking in English to improve students' listening so that they are used to it and can respond. Based on these results, From the data based on observations, interviews, and document analysis above, outdoor learning by inviting students to see material objects directly from nature is considered effective. What teachers apply with this method to students is successfully meeting all kinds of targets for each material, especially in increasing English language skills, which can be seen from their mastery of vocabulary. Apart from that, outdoor learning is also considered to prevent students from getting bored quickly and being enthusiastic about following all the material the teacher provides.
From Concept to Practice: The Reality of Religious Moderation in State Islamic Universities in Aceh Razak, Abd; A. Rasyid, Saifuddin; Syah Putra, Rahmad; Khatami, M.; Muntazhar, Asyraf

Abstract

This study examines the implementation of Religious Moderation (Moderasi Beragama/MB) in State Islamic Higher Education Institutions (PTKIN) in Aceh, Indonesia, within the framework of national policy and local religious dynamics. Using empirical data and institutional analysis, the research identifies key structural and cultural factors affecting the success of this agenda. While the concept of moderation is compatible with Acehnese Islamic traditions, institutionalization remains limited due to its exclusion from strategic planning, inadequate funding, and varied reception among academic communities. UIN Ar-Raniry Banda Aceh stands out for its more structured and sustained approach, supported by strong leadership and resource commitment. In contrast, other PTKINs show fragmented, ad hoc efforts shaped by institutional and financial constraints. The study finds that localized strategies—rooted in contextual theology, cultural practices, and credible religious authority—are more effective in embedding moderation values within academic settings. These findings underscore that successful implementation of religious moderation in higher education depends on integrating policy with institutional will and cultural engagement, allowing national agendas to resonate meaningfully within diverse local contexts.
Religious Moderation Literacy Index of PTKIN Students in Aceh: Analysis of Islamic Knowledge and Understanding Marhamah, Marhamah; Rohana, Sy.; Putra, Rahmad Syah; Khatami, M.; Hamarita, Mela

Abstract

Religion should be a guideline for life and a filter against deviations in society. However, currently there is a growing understanding that leads to excessive and extreme religious practices, which are contrary to the essence of religious teachings themselves. To overcome this, the Ministry of Religion issued a policy on Strengthening Religious Moderation in PTKIN, which aims to be a space for sowing, educating, mentoring, and strengthening the religious moderation movement in the campus environment. This study uses a Mixed Methods approach with a survey to compile the components of the Religious Moderation Literacy Index (ILMB) based on a study by the Ministry of Religion. The research sample consisted of 100 PTKIN students in Aceh selected purposively with a 10% margin of error. Data were collected through observation, interviews, and questionnaires, then analyzed inductively based on the theory of religious moderation literacy and Islamic values. The results showed that the religious moderation literacy index of PTKIN students in Aceh was 50.48, which is relatively low. The basic understanding value of 57.67 and advanced understanding of 37.97 indicate that understanding of religious moderation needs to be improved. The students' knowledge of religious moderation that is not yet optimal shows the need for synergy between stakeholders and the use of social media. Strengthening religious moderation literacy in Aceh requires a comprehensive approach, including the integration of Islamic values in education and the use of digital media.
Banda Aceh as a Civilized City Model: (A Theory and Reality Study) Manan, Abdul; Muhazar, Muhazar; Syahputra, Rahmad; Salasiyah, Cut Intan

Abstract

This research studied the City Government’s endeavor of Banda Aceh to make the city as a civilized city model. Describing the efforts and constraints faced by the government, revealing responses of local citizens, and defining the present conditions of the city became the objective. A qualitative approach covering field observations, documents, and interviews, was applied and followed by data reduction, data display, and concluding. By involving related stakeholders, the new government duo headed by Aminullah Usman and Zainal Arifin has extended the Medium-term Development Plan to realize anew Long-term Development, Land Use, and Area Plan. Nevertheless, a lack of participation in the implementation of sharia appeared, less than optimal governance systems and uneven economic empowerment. Those generated varied responses from the lower, middle, and upper-class citizens. Therefore, to bring the glory of Banda Aceh, the duo has launched the concept of Banda Aceh the Brilliant City.
